Oct 3, 201114 yr Ting, the interviews are designed to find out how each of us communicates and makes sure that we have a good handle on the English language. Typically, they interview 100-110 people and 90 are offered admission and there are several alternates if some of the 90 choose to go somewhere else and decline the offer. The best thing to do is to go into the interview with a positive attitude and participate in the activities and just relax... Most people who have gone through the interview process have said that it's not stressful and even kind of fun. Hope that helps!!!
